Q: Is 129,556,722 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 129,556,722 is a composite number.

Why is 129,556,722 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 129,556,722 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 47 94 141 282 459,421 918,842 1,378,263 2,756,526 21,592,787 43,185,574 64,778,361 and 129,556,722, with no remainder.

Since 129,556,722 cannot be divided by just 1 and 129,556,722, it is a composite number.
